Carlos San Pedro, owner and technical director of Bodegas y Viñedos Pujanza, is also the forth
generation of a family of vine-growers, wine-makers and wine merchants of Laguardia. Bodegas
y Viñedos Pujanza is his more personal project. A dream which was born during his childhood
and has gone taking shape with the years until become a splendid fact. In 1998, Carlos already
has in property 15 has of vineyard and decides to produce his first own wine, his first Pujanza.

LAGUARDIA
Bodegas y Viñedos Pujanza is located in Laguardia, in the heart of Rioja Alavesa, one of the
most beautiful villages in Spain, both for its cultural and historical heritage and for the people who
live and work its lands.
Winery is situated at the foot of Sierra de Cantabria, surrounded by some of most characteristic
vineyards, in an area where altitude starts to be a limiting factor for this crop. It is an exclusive
place to contemplate a lovely view from the hill of Laguardia and witness the evolution of the
vineyard during the year. Sierra de Cantabria is not only the north border of the Designation. It
also operates as a natural frontier for villages and crops of this area creating a perfect climate for
the vines.

HISTORY
Bodegas y Viñedos Pujanza starts in 1998 producing only a wine: Pujanza.
While facilities are built, wines are made in the familiar winery until 2001 when first harvest is
carried out in the new winery. 2001 was an excellent vintage in this area. An spacious and
simple building, mainly thought for the efficiency and comfort of the daily work. A viewpoint tower
crowned the winery, where it has been placed a tasting room, and from where it is possible to
enjoy a panoramic view over the vineyards, Sierra de Cantabria and east wall of Laguardia.

Bodegas y Viñedos Pujanza, Laguardia. Philosophy of the winery is well defined from the beginning. Wine must be produced in the
vineyard and so our greatest effort is made there, understanding and having the best knowledge
of every single vineyard. In Pujanza we only used grapes form our own vineyards. Some of these
plots already belonged to Carlos San Pedro’s family, as Finca La Valcabada, origin of Pujanza
Cisma, and other have been bought by him during last years.
OUR VINEYARDS
Pujanza has in property 40 has. of vineyard, all of them in Laguardia, from which we produced all
of our wines. We cultivate only Tempranillo, an indigenous red grape variety from Rioja, except in
one very special vineyard where we cultivate Viura, white grape variety, to produce our only white
wine, Añadas Frías. These four are the most representative vineyards in Pujanza: FINCA VALDEPOLEO 17,5 has. (43,2 acres) vineyard planted in 1973 at 630 m. (2.067 ft.). of altitude. Clay-limestone soil. Yield: 4.500 kg/ha. (1.800 kg/ac.).

VINEGROWING
Our essential work is realized in the vineyard. Through viticulture we try to obtain the most representative and high quality grapes in every parcel. Thus, it is in the vineyard where we make the greatest effort and a very accurate work, always developing a friendly viticulture with the crop and the environment around it. During previous month before harvest, many grape samplings in every plot are realized to know the evolution in the ripening and be able to decide the right moment to pick grapes from every vineyard. Harvest is made by hand and grapes are transported to the winery in 20 kg plastic crates in order to keep quality of the grapes. During picking, a selection of the right bunches is also made, leaving on the plant those don’t meet the criteria for the winemaking. Once in winery, if it is necessary, we will do a second selection of bunches in the sorting table. It is unusual to make this second selection because the good health of the grapes and the selection made in the vineyard.

WINEMAKING
Pujanza winemaking follows traditional process with an accurate control. Fermentation took place in 15.000 L. stainless steel vats, excluding Pujanza Cisma and Añadas Frías. Pujanza Cisma is elaborated in a 1.700 kg. Barrel box, a structure of stainless steel with oak staves faces, and Añadas Frías is made and aged in two barrels of 225 and 500 L. Our top is a thorough control of timing and temperatures in every tank, in order to preserve quality and personality obtained in the vineyard.
AGING
Every Pujanza wine is aged a minimum of 12 month in French oak barrels from best forests. Although we have not a large number of barrels, we use casks from different coopers in order to add to our wines a higher complexity that goes along with character obtained in the vineyard. As during winemaking, our best tool to control wine evolution in the barrels is tasting them often, to be able to take right decisions in perfect moments.
